Ameobi fires double in USA

By Daily Sports on June 9, 2017

 Newcastle-born Nigerian Tomi Ameobi has rediscovered his goal scoring abilities after he netted a brace to help FC Edmonton defeat hosts New York Cosmos 4-2 in a USA NASL game.

FC Edmonton are now sixth on the league table with 10 points from 10 games.

The 28-year-old younger brother of Shola Ameobi scored in the 72nd minute to give his team the lead for the first time in the game at 2-1.

He then sealed the victory when he made it 4-1 in the 89th minute to take his goals’ haul to three in 10 games.
